At today's meeting of the Turkish Defense Industry Executive Committee at the Presidential Palace chaired by Erdogan, planning for the next constructions of the Turkish Navy was done, which is second to none in terms of size and scope.

It was decided that:

  • To pursue the design of the “National Aircraft Carrier”. Erdogan announced last year. The assumption here is that it will be a larger and improved version of the TCG Anadolu that has already entered the Turkish Navy.
  • 4 more to advance in the line of Istanbul-class warships. Built first in Turkey, it has ordered 3 more at 3 different shipyards for parallel construction, so now announces its intention to double the class.
  • Continue to purchase new offshore patrol boats. This is about the Hisar class of ships, of which the first 2 were delivered last year and it was announced that the class will reach all 10 ships. Therefore, we have confirmed that their construction will continue (no new boats announced). The boats are basically Ada-class corvettes, but with upgrades and the ability to carry heavier weapons.
  • Develop plans for new landing craft, new mines and missile boats. In all these, Turkey has very old materials and wants to improve it.

Central to all of the above, design, manufacturing and equipment will be done in Turkey. Percentage of domestic value added reaching 80% or more.

Needless to say, if the above is even partially implemented (in Turkey postponement or changes in equipment orders or changes in announcements are rare). The country's navy will be significantly upgraded in terms of number of ships, firepower, and more systems, software, etc. Exclusively manufactured locally, hence ease of manufacturing and direct support.

The aim for a large navy is certainly consistent with Turkish ambitions to control much of the eastern Mediterranean, claim the natural resources there, and have a strong presence in the Aegean, as well as control Greece. sovereignty. The third role here is to strengthen Turkey in the Black Sea, where it has already started pumping natural gas and sees a “power vacuum” that it wants to close with its own intervention.
